Cloud Engineer (m/w)

Job Informationen

Your tasks: Contribute to the design and development of our serverless cloud backend applications, with interfaces to the drone system, user-facing dashboard, and client-specific APIs. Identify new relevant technologies and services and propose architectural patterns that ensure performance, scalability, and reliability of our solutions. Collaborate closely with our team of software engineers and UX designers, to design high-quality solutions that deliver high value to our clients and are a pleasure to use. Ensure the highest standards of software quality through unit and integration tests, and by defining (new) local and remote testing processes and infrastructure. Spread knowledge about cloud solutions within the department and enable other developers as we continue our shift towards the cloud. Assist with the analysis of general and client-specific requirements. Participate on daily activities of the team, such as code and design reviews, project planning, periodic meetings, etc. Mentor and train other team members on design techniques and coding standards. Your profile: Degree (MSc, BSc) in computer science, software engineering, or relevant field. At least 4+ years of professional hands-on experience in software engineering, with focus on developing and designing cloud-based applications and services Proven experience in the development and design of scalable, performant, robust and fault-tolerant micro-service and serverless architectures Proven experience in NoSQL data modeling Strong commitment to high coding and design/architecture standards and best practices Practical experience delivering in agile environments Fluent in English, both written and spoken Additional plus: Expertise in AWS services, including Lambda, DynamoDB, SNS, SQS, EventBridge, S3, ELB, etc. Experience with containers. Experience with large architectures, serving many clients and users. Experience in dealing with partner companies and collaborating with remote teams. Experience with tracing, monitoring and alerting. Experience with IoT/robotics applications. Proficiency in C++. Tools and frameworks: Python + Pytest, AWS Chalice, Docker, Gitlab, Terraform, REST, WebSocket API, Git, JIRA

Benötigte Skills
  • Linux
  • Systemarchitektur
  • CLOUD
  • Python
  • C++
  • Python
  • NoSQL
  • Bachelor
  • Master
Job Details
  • Pensum Vollzeit